What do you have the REFRESH RATE set to?
(max at that resolution is 75Hz)

Windows XP has a problem with detecting correct refresh rates.
If it is set to low it can cause the artifact issues you are encountering.

Have you updated to the newest driver for your video card? Some drivers may not be compatible with DirectX 9.0b. Even if you have the newest drivers try re-installing them (first uninstall the current drivers and after rebooting set the video card as standard SVGA card. Then reboot again and install the newest drivers for you video card.
